[4.7.3] Engine crashes on compile of one blueprint only if child of that blueprint is also opened in another tab

This is a strange bug. If I open one of my blueprints (“Building”) and compile it, everything works. But if I have another blueprint opened in another tab and this other blueprint is a child of “Building” then Engine crashes ~10 seconds after I hit compile of Building, before it’s crashing it’s just freezed.

I tried it now 4 times, it crashes every single time if child blueprint is opened.
